radKIDS at a Glance

radKIDS is the national leader in children's safety. radKIDS is brought to children and parents by the training and development of nationally certified instructors drawn from their own communities. By empowering a community with certified local instructors, the radKIDS Personal Empowerment Safety Education package is not just a program but a true gift to the community.

      

      

 
radKIDS Curriculum topics include:

  • Home, School and Vehicle Safety
  • Out and About Safety
  • Realistic Defense Against Abduction
  • Good-Bad-Uncomfortable Touch and more.
  • Stranger Tricks (including Physical Defense against Abduction)
  • Self-realization of personal power

National Network

Community-based organizations receive training and support from national headquarters to provide the radKIDS program as a part of their own youth work. These groups, which have safety goals compatible with those of radKIDS, include police departments, educational organizations, civic groups, fraternal organizations, citizens' groups and concerned parents.
